Classic White Subway TilesNothing beats the timeless appeal of classic white subway tiles. They can create a clean and bright atmosphere in your kitchen. Pair them with dark cabinetry for a striking contrast or with light wood accents for a more rustic feel. The beauty of white subway tiles lies in their ability to blend seamlessly with any design style.2. Colorful Subway Tiles for a Pop of PersonalityIf you're looking to add some personality to your kitchen, consider colorful subway tiles. Shades like deep teal, vibrant yellow, or rich navy can transform your space. You could use them as an accent behind the stove or wrap them around the entire backsplash. Remember, a little color can go a long way!3. Unique Patterns with Subway TilesExperimenting with patterns can make your subway tile backsplash truly unique. You can arrange your tiles in herringbone, chevron, or even a staggered pattern for a more dynamic look. Combining different colors or finishes can also add depth and interest to the design.4. Textured Subway Tiles for Added DepthTextured subway tiles introduce a tactile element to your kitchen. Consider options like matte finishes or tiles with ridges or grooves. These textures can reflect light differently and create a stunning visual appeal. Plus, they are easier to maintain as they tend to hide fingerprints and smudges.5. Mixing Materials with Subway TilesDon’t be afraid to mix materials! Combine subway tiles with natural stone or reclaimed wood for a personalized look.
